Understanding Kinesiology Tools

Kinesiology tools encompass a wide range of devices and instruments designed to assess, measure, and improve body movement and muscle function. These tools aid in:

  • Diagnosing musculoskeletal imbalances
  • Measuring muscle strength and flexibility
  • Enhancing manual therapy techniques
  • Tracking rehabilitation progress
  • Facilitating patient education and motivation

Selecting the appropriate tools depends on your therapeutic approach, patient population, budget, and practice setting.

Key Considerations When Choosing Kinesiology Tools

1. Define Your Therapy Goals

Before purchasing any equipment, clarify the specific goals of your kinesiology practice. Are you primarily focused on muscular strength testing? Rehabilitation exercises? Posture analysis? Or perhaps neurological assessments?

For instance:
– If your goal is to evaluate muscle strength accurately, you may prioritize handheld dynamometers.
– For posture correction and biomechanical analysis, motion capture systems or posture grids might be more relevant.
– If your focus is on soft tissue treatment, instruments like massage tools or myofascial release devices could be essential.

By defining your goals early on, you can narrow down your tool choices to those that directly support your therapeutic objectives.

2. Consider the Type of Patients You Serve

Your patient demographic influences the type of kinesiology tools you’ll need. Pediatric patients require different approaches compared to athletes or elderly populations. For example:
– Tools with adjustable settings and ergonomic designs are vital when working with children or individuals with limited mobility.
– Athletes may benefit from high-precision measurement devices that track subtle changes in performance.
– Geriatric patients might require gentle therapy aids that enhance circulation and flexibility without causing strain.

Understanding your patient base helps tailor your equipment choices to their needs.

3. Evaluate Usability and Training Requirements

Some kinesiology tools are straightforward handheld devices requiring minimal training (e.g., reflex hammers), while others involve sophisticated software (e.g., 3D gait analysis systems).

Consider:
– How much time you or your staff can dedicate to learning new equipment?
– Is there adequate technical support or training available from suppliers?
– Will the tool integrate smoothly into your current workflow?

Choosing user-friendly tools reduces frustration and enhances adoption rates among therapists.

4. Assess Accuracy and Reliability

Precision is critical in kinesiology assessments. Inaccurate data can lead to misdiagnosis or ineffective treatment plans.

Look for:
– Devices with proven clinical validation
– Tools calibrated regularly or with self-calibration features
– Equipment recommended by professional organizations or peer-reviewed studies

Reading product reviews, consulting colleagues, and attending trade shows can provide insights into reliability.

5. Factor in Portability and Storage

Depending on whether your practice operates in a fixed clinic space or offers mobile services, portability may be a key factor.

  • Compact and lightweight devices are ideal for home visits or sports field assessments.
  • Larger machines might provide more comprehensive data but require dedicated space.

Also consider storage needs, tools should be easy to store safely when not in use.

6. Review Budget Constraints

Kinesiology tools vary widely in price, from affordable resistance bands to expensive motion capture systems costing several thousand dollars.

Balance cost against expected benefits:
– Start with essential basic tools if you’re setting up a new practice.
– Invest in advanced technology as your practice grows and demands increase.
– Look for multi-functional devices that serve several purposes to maximize value.

Check for warranty terms, maintenance costs, and supplier reputation to ensure sound financial investment.

Common Types of Kinesiology Tools for Therapy

Handheld Dynamometers

Used for measuring muscle strength quantitatively by applying resistance during muscle contraction. They are portable, easy to use, and indispensable for objective tracking of muscle function during rehabilitation.

Pros:
– Accurate strength measurements
– Portable design
– Useful in diverse settings (clinic/home)

Cons:
– May require some training for consistent application
– Limited to isometric strength testing unless paired with other equipment

Electromyography (EMG) Devices

EMG tools measure electrical activity produced by muscles during contraction. They help identify abnormal muscle activation patterns often seen in neuromuscular disorders.

Pros:
– Provides detailed muscle activation data
– Useful in diagnosis as well as therapy monitoring
– Can be integrated with biofeedback systems

Cons:
– Expensive equipment requiring technical expertise
– Setup can be time-consuming

Goniometers and Inclinometers

These instruments measure joint angles and range of motion. They are fundamental for assessing flexibility limitations or post-surgical recovery progress.

Pros:
– Simple design
– Cost-effective
– Easy to learn usage techniques

Cons:
– Manual measurements may introduce user error
– Limited data compared to digital systems

Resistance Bands and Tubing

Elastic bands come in various resistance levels used extensively in strengthening exercises tailored by therapists according to patient ability.

Pros:
– Affordable and portable
– Versatile exercise options
– Suitable across all fitness levels

Cons:
– No direct measurement capability unless paired with sensors
– Bands degrade over time needing replacement

Posture Assessment Tools

Examples include plumb lines, posture grids, digital posture analyzers, and smartphone apps designed to detect alignment abnormalities affecting movement efficiency.

Pros:
– Immediate visual feedback aids patient education
– Assists in customizing therapy plans targeting postural correction

Cons:
– Some digital systems require investment in software/hardware
– Interpretation skills necessary for accuracy

Massage and Soft Tissue Therapy Tools

Includes foam rollers, massage balls, percussion massagers used alongside manual techniques to reduce muscle tension and promote circulation.

Pros:
– Enhances therapeutic effects easily applied by patients themselves too
– Wide variety available across price points

Cons:
– Effectiveness depends on correct use technique
– Not diagnostic tools per se but complementary aids
